Table 5-18 Grounding specifications for communication power supplies
No.
Description
1
The inlet for the AC power cable at the equipment room should be equipped with a
surge protection device (C-level) with a nominal discharge current no less than 20
kA.
2
The protection ground for the power supply and that for communication equipment
share the same grounding conductor. If the power supply and the equipment are in
the same equipment room, use the same protection ground bar for them if possible.
3
Use a surge protection circuit on the AC power interface.
4
The positive of the -48 V DC power supply or negative pole of the 24 V DC power
supply should be grounded at the output of the DC power supply.
5
The working ground and protection ground of the DC power supply equipment
should use the same grounding conductor with the protection ground of the
switching equipment. If the power supply and equipment are in the same
equipment room, use the same protection ground bar for them if possible.
6
Add surge protection on the DC power interface.
5.3.5 Grounding Specifications for Signal Cables
Grounding specifications for signal cables are shown in Table 5-19.
Table 5-19 Grounding specifications for signal cables
No.
Description
1
Equip the cable outdoors with a metal jacket, well grounded at both ends, or
connect the ends of the metal jacket to the protection ground bar of the equipment
room. For cables inside the equipment room, install surge protection devices at the
interface to the equipment. The PGND cable for the surge protection devices
should be as short as possible.
2
The incoming and outgoing signal cables to and from the office and unused wires
inside the cable should be grounded for protection.
3
The Tone & Data Access (TDA) cable must pass through the Main Distribution
Frame (MDF) with surge protective device (SPD) when going out of the office.
The cable's shield layer should be connected to the protection ground of the MDF.
The MDF should use the same grounding conductor with the cabinet.
4
The signal cables should not be routed overhead.
